氟硅酸钾容量法定量测试硅藻泥中二氧化硅含量

    摘要:用氟硅酸钾容量法对硅藻泥中二氧化硅含量进行定量测试。硅藻土中无定型二氧化硅的碱溶性质与结晶型二氧化硅不同,可以在碱溶液中溶出。根据碱溶前后样品中的二氧化硅含量,计算硅藻泥中无定型二氧化硅含量。该方法重复性好,变异系数(RSD)为1.49%~4.21%,适用于硅藻泥中二氧化硅含量的定量测试。对49个硅藻泥样品中二氧化硅含量进行测试,二氧化硅含量在0.8%~27.2%,平均值为7.7%,结果表明,不同来源硅藻泥之间二氧化硅含量差异很大。
    关键词:硅藻泥;二氧化硅;氟硅酸钾容量法;定量

The application of potassium fluosilicate volumetric method for quantitative determination of silicon dioxide content in diatom ooze

    Abstract:The potassium fluosilicate volumetric method for quantitative determination of silicon dioxide content in diatom ooze was researched. Alkali solubility of amorphous silicon dioxide in diatom ooze is different with crystal silicon dioxide and can be dissolved in alkaline solution. The content of amorphous silicon dioxide in diatom ooze can be calculated according to the silicon dioxide content of samples before and after dissolving in alkaline solution. Test results show that the method has good reproducibility with the relative standard deviations(RSD) of 1.49%~4.21% and is suitable for determination of silicon dioxide
content in diatom ooze. Forty-nine diatom ooze samples were determined and the content of silicon dioxide were 0.8%~27.2% with average content of 7.7%. Results show that there is significant difference of silicon dioxide content in different samples.
